The Heitsche wedding was the warmest October wedding I’ve ever shot, and one of the most beautiful! Sunny and 70 degrees, with trees turning to yellow and orange all around us. It was absolutely perfect!

The ceremony was held on private property down a long stone dirt road in the woods. All the decorating (both at the ceremony and the reception) was done by the owner of the property, Amy Battles. She did a phenomenal job with everything! There was a beautiful arbor for Allison & Troy to say their vows underneath, and huge mums surrounding the arbor, backed by the fall colors in the trees. Talk about dreamy!

Before heading to the reception, we stopped at a stone quarry (owned by Troy’s parents) for the Bride & Groom and Bridal Party portraits. The light was perfect, and the stones acted as a natural reflector around us, and I absolutely loved the portraits that came from our time there! We even utilized some of the equipment down in the quarry in some of our pictures. The whole bridal party was great to work with and fun, as well as the bride & groom! I loved working with them all.

The reception was just as lovely as the ceremony, complete with my favorite dessert…cheesecake! The couple opted for mini-cheesecakes for their guests, and then a cheesecake for the two of them to enjoy…and smash all over each other’s faces! 

All in all, this wedding was absolutely perfect, and one that I would gladly repeat!
